How to Pronounce Yangchuanosaurus
yang-choo-AHN-oh-SORE-us
ALL CAPS = stressed syllable
What does Yangchuanosaurus mean?
Lizard from Yongchuan, China
Name Roots
"Yangchuan"
Yongchuan district in Chongqing, China, where the fossil was found
"saurus"
lizard, from ancient Greek 'sauros'
Fun Facts
- âThe original Yangchuanosaurus fossil skull measures about 82 centimeters long, making it one of the largest predator skulls ever found from Jurassic Asia.
- âYangchuanosaurus shared its ecosystem with Mamenchisaurus, a sauropod whose neck alone stretched up to 10 meters, meaning the predator had to tackle prey almost twice its own length.
- âPaleontologist Dong Zhiming, who led the team that described Yangchuanosaurus in 1978, went on to become one of the most prolific dinosaur hunters in Chinese history, naming dozens of species.
- âThe raised neural spines along Yangchuanosaurus's backbone may have supported a ridge of muscle or even a low sail-like structure, giving it a distinctive silhouette unlike most other large predators of its time.
- âYangchuanosaurus belongs to Metriacanthosauridae, a family of predators so specialized that scientists once debated for decades whether they were more closely related to Allosaurus or to the spinosaurs, and the argument only settled after detailed bone analysis in the 2000s.
